Company Description

Tuk In Foods is an award-winning food brand known for bringing authentic Indian street food to homes and workplaces across the country. Established in 2015 with the launch of their innovative Curry-in-a-Naan, the company has since expanded its offerings to include ready meals, Indian snacks, and a line of handmade condiments. Based in Leicester, Tuk In Foods is dedicated to creating restaurant-quality food, which has earned them over 300 5-star reviews from satisfied customers. They provide a seamless service experience, including an online store with next-day delivery across the UK.

Role Purpose

The Technical Manager is responsible for leading and maintaining all food safety, quality, legality and compliance systems across Tuk In Foods Manufacturing. This role ensures that all products manufactured across both sites meet BRCGS, legal and customer standards while supporting business growth, innovation and continuous improvement.

The role spans high care and low care environments and includes oversight of New Product Development (NPD), raw materials, supplier approval, audits, complaints and factory hygiene systems.

Key ResponsibilitiesFood Safety & Quality Systems

  • Own and maintain the BRCGS Food Safety Management System for both sites
  • Ensure full compliance with:
  • BRCGS
  • UK Food Law
  • Customer codes of practice
  • HACCP & allergen management
  • Lead and maintain the HACCP system, ensuring it remains robust, validated and up to date
  • Manage site risk assessments for high care and low care areas, including zoning, segregation and controls

Audit & Compliance

  • Lead all BRC audits, customer audits and regulatory inspections
  • Maintain audit readiness across both sites at all times
  • Manage non-conformances, root cause analysis and corrective actions
  • Ensure traceability, mass balance and product recall systems are fully tested and effective

Technical Leadership

  • Lead and develop the Technical / QA Team across both sites
  • Provide daily technical support to Production, Engineering and NPD
  • Act as the technical authority for food safety decisions
  • Build a strong food safety culture throughout the business

NPD & Product Approval

  • Oversee technical approval of new products, recipes, ingredients and suppliers
  • Ensure all new products meet:
  • Legal labelling requirements
  • Customer specifications
  • Food safety and allergen controls
  • Lead shelf-life validation and challenge testing where required

Supplier & Raw Material Assurance

  • Manage supplier approval and monitoring
  • Ensure all raw materials meet Tuk In Foods’ food safety and quality standards
  • Review supplier audits, specifications and risk ratings

High Care & Low Care Control

  • Maintain robust segregation, hygiene and environmental monitoring programs
  • Ensure correct controls for:
  • Pathogen management
  • Cleaning validation
  • Personal hygiene
  • Zoning & flow
  • Lead investigations and corrective actions where issues arise

Complaints, Incidents & Continuous Improvement

  • Lead all customer complaints and quality incidents
  • Carry out root cause analysis and implement preventive actions
  • Drive continuous improvement in:
  • Food safety
  • Quality standards
  • Factory hygiene
  • Documentation and reporting
